Does the presenter of the workshop get credit for presenting the workshop and providing the CLE or would he or she need to actually attend a different CLE course?

0

Response: VA regulations require the completion of qualifying CLE as a condition of accreditation. If a State bar association awards an individual credit for presenting qualifying veterans law CLE, VA will accept that for purposes of accreditation provided that it meets all the other requirements of 38 C.F.R. ยง 14.629(b)(iii).
